POST api/v1/Locks
Adds new lock
Request Information
URI Parameters
None.
Body Parameters
InsertLockParamName | Description | Type | Additional information |
---|---|---|---|
Lock |
Lock information |
LockInsert |
None. |
SecurityAccesses |
Security accesses which are set for the new lock |
Collection of LockSecurityAccessInsert |
None. |
TimeLimit |
Time limit information for the new lock |
LockTimeLimit |
None. |
LockRelay |
Lock relay information |
LockRelay |
None. |
Request Formats
application/json, text/json
Sample:
{ "Lock": { "FLock_ID": "b2baedc4-738f-4ac2-bdaa-f8c1473d131a", "ClockInstalled": true, "ClockInstalledDateUtc": "2025-07-06T18:17:52.1510175+03:00", "Description": "sample string 2", "Direction": "sample string 3", "DoorThickness": "sample string 4", "DoorType": "sample string 5", "Ext": 6, "ExtDescription": "sample string 7", "ExtentionPiece": "sample string 8", "Handed": "sample string 9", "KeyChamber": "sample string 10", "LocationCode": "sample string 11", "LockFramework": "sample string 12", "LockFrameworkDepth": "sample string 13", "LockingObject": "sample string 14", "LockType": 15, "Mounting": "sample string 16", "OtherEquipment": "sample string 17", "RealEstate_Id": "43fd71c4-588d-46da-8e28-da844167fa79", "Stamp": "sample string 19", "Zone_ID": "80011266-16b8-4bca-a41f-bf566d5b0516", "DataVersion": 20, "DefaultProgramStationFProgKey_ID": "37bdb0cf-1d19-43c3-9fbd-56ba20caf498", "HwVersion": 21, "FloorPlan_ID": "4c1cb01d-055c-48b0-aabe-e1944b26e56d", "FloorPlanPointX": 22.1, "FloorPlanPointY": 23.1, "LockCode": "sample string 24", "LockSettings": "sample string 25", "ManufacturingInfo": "sample string 26", "MechVersion": 27, "Secret": "sample string 28", "SerialNumber": 29, "SwVersion": 30 }, "SecurityAccesses": [ { "RelayMask": 1, "SecurityAccess_ID": "4c519222-e6d9-4b78-8211-89a50f6d0b5c" }, { "RelayMask": 1, "SecurityAccess_ID": "4c519222-e6d9-4b78-8211-89a50f6d0b5c" } ], "TimeLimit": { "HighSecurity": true, "TimeLimitMask": 2 }, "LockRelay": { "RelayK1Delay": 1, "RelayK2Delay": 2, "RelayMask": 3, "RelayMode": 4, "RelayNameData": "sample string 5", "RelayPacket": true, "RelayQuasarDelay": 7, "RelayQuasarMode": 8 } }
application/xml, text/xml
Sample:
<LockParams.InsertLockParam x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/iloq.manager.server.ws.WebApi.Params"> <Lock xmlns:d2p1="http://schemas.datacontract.org/2004/07/iloq.manager.server.bus"> <d2p1:ClockInstalled>true</d2p1:ClockInstalled> <d2p1:ClockInstalledDateUtc>2025-07-06T18:17:52.1510175+03:00</d2p1:ClockInstalledDateUtc> <d2p1:DataVersion>20</d2p1:DataVersion> <d2p1:DefaultProgramStationFProgKey_ID>37bdb0cf-1d19-43c3-9fbd-56ba20caf498</d2p1:DefaultProgramStationFProgKey_ID> <d2p1:Description>sample string 2</d2p1:Description> <d2p1:Direction>sample string 3</d2p1:Direction> <d2p1:DoorThickness>sample string 4</d2p1:DoorThickness> <d2p1:DoorType>sample string 5</d2p1:DoorType> <d2p1:Ext>6</d2p1:Ext> <d2p1:ExtDescription>sample string 7</d2p1:ExtDescription> <d2p1:ExtentionPiece>sample string 8</d2p1:ExtentionPiece> <d2p1:FLock_ID>b2baedc4-738f-4ac2-bdaa-f8c1473d131a</d2p1:FLock_ID> <d2p1:FloorPlanPointX>22.1</d2p1:FloorPlanPointX> <d2p1:FloorPlanPointY>23.1</d2p1:FloorPlanPointY> <d2p1:FloorPlan_ID>4c1cb01d-055c-48b0-aabe-e1944b26e56d</d2p1:FloorPlan_ID> <d2p1:Handed>sample string 9</d2p1:Handed> <d2p1:HwVersion>21</d2p1:HwVersion> <d2p1:KeyChamber>sample string 10</d2p1:KeyChamber> <d2p1:LocationCode>sample string 11</d2p1:LocationCode> <d2p1:LockCode>sample string 24</d2p1:LockCode> <d2p1:LockFramework>sample string 12</d2p1:LockFramework> <d2p1:LockFrameworkDepth>sample string 13</d2p1:LockFrameworkDepth> <d2p1:LockSettings>sample string 25</d2p1:LockSettings> <d2p1:LockType>15</d2p1:LockType> <d2p1:LockingObject>sample string 14</d2p1:LockingObject> <d2p1:ManufacturingInfo>sample string 26</d2p1:ManufacturingInfo> <d2p1:MechVersion>27</d2p1:MechVersion> <d2p1:Mounting>sample string 16</d2p1:Mounting> <d2p1:OtherEquipment>sample string 17</d2p1:OtherEquipment> <d2p1:RealEstate_Id>43fd71c4-588d-46da-8e28-da844167fa79</d2p1:RealEstate_Id> <d2p1:Secret>sample string 28</d2p1:Secret> <d2p1:SerialNumber>29</d2p1:SerialNumber> <d2p1:Stamp>sample string 19</d2p1:Stamp> <d2p1:SwVersion>30</d2p1:SwVersion> <d2p1:Zone_ID>80011266-16b8-4bca-a41f-bf566d5b0516</d2p1:Zone_ID> </Lock> <LockRelay xmlns:d2p1="http://schemas.datacontract.org/2004/07/iloq.manager.server.bus"> <d2p1:RelayK1Delay>1</d2p1:RelayK1Delay> <d2p1:RelayK2Delay>2</d2p1:RelayK2Delay> <d2p1:RelayMask>3</d2p1:RelayMask> <d2p1:RelayMode>4</d2p1:RelayMode> <d2p1:RelayNameData>sample string 5</d2p1:RelayNameData> <d2p1:RelayPacket>true</d2p1:RelayPacket> <d2p1:RelayQuasarDelay>7</d2p1:RelayQuasarDelay> <d2p1:RelayQuasarMode>8</d2p1:RelayQuasarMode> </LockRelay> <SecurityAccesses xmlns:d2p1="http://schemas.datacontract.org/2004/07/iloq.manager.server.bus"> <d2p1:LockSecurityAccessInsert> <d2p1:RelayMask>1</d2p1:RelayMask> <d2p1:SecurityAccess_ID>4c519222-e6d9-4b78-8211-89a50f6d0b5c</d2p1:SecurityAccess_ID> </d2p1:LockSecurityAccessInsert> <d2p1:LockSecurityAccessInsert> <d2p1:RelayMask>1</d2p1:RelayMask> <d2p1:SecurityAccess_ID>4c519222-e6d9-4b78-8211-89a50f6d0b5c</d2p1:SecurityAccess_ID> </d2p1:LockSecurityAccessInsert> </SecurityAccesses> <TimeLimit xmlns:d2p1="http://schemas.datacontract.org/2004/07/iloq.manager.server.bus"> <d2p1:HighSecurity>true</d2p1:HighSecurity> <d2p1:TimeLimitMask>2</d2p1:TimeLimitMask> </TimeLimit> </LockParams.InsertLockParam>
application/x-www-form-urlencoded
Sample:
Sample not available.
Response Information
Resource Description
IHttpActionResultNone.
Response Formats
application/json, text/json, application/xml, text/xml
Sample:
Sample not available.